Freshly Ground Coffee If you're a connoisseur of coffee, then you know that freshly ground beans make a much richer and more flavourful cup of coffee than pre-ground. Whole coffee beans oxidize slower than ground coffee and release more oils and aromas when brewed. Bean to cup coffee machines are designed to work with both whole beans and pre-ground coffee but the majority of people find they enjoy the taste of freshly ground coffee the most. One of the main advantages of bean to cup coffee machines is that they typically require less maintenance than traditional machines. It is essential to clean and decal the machine frequently to ensure it operates efficiently. This will stop the coffee from developing an unpleasant taste and it will help to safeguard the machine from damage. Generally, the machine will need to be cleaned by emptying the waste tank and wiping off any surfaces. It is also necessary to clean out the steam pipe which froths milk to make cappuccinos or lattes. If it is not cleaned, this pipe can become blocked with a build-up of milk residue and bacteria. It is also essential to regularly descale the machine to get rid of any build-up of scale. This will protect the machine from damaging the heating element and improve the quality of the coffee. In general, the machine will have an integrated descaling program and it will indicate when the descale cycle is due.
